Spring Break travel tips

As spring break approaches, thousands of us will become sun-seekers seeking respite from winter’s frosty embrace. Many of you will head to popular destinations, ready to bask under the golden sun and looking for endless beach parties. However, if you’re like me, you may be longing for a quieter escape from the clichéd crowds. To that I say: embrace the hidden gems!
Instead of surrendering to the usual tourist destinations, I urge you…..no, I COMPEL YOU to venture off the beaten path and discover unique experiences. Here are a few tips to help you make the most of your spring break adventure:
1. Research: Spend some time researching alternative locations that are less crowded but still offering the experiences you want. Look for destinations that offer a combination of history, robust energy, natural beauty, cultural experiences, and activities that align with your interests.
2. Avoid Peak Travel Dates: Consider traveling during non-peak periods and shoulder seasons. Look at weekdays or earlier/later in the season when the crowds are home busy with work or school. By doing this, you'll have less crowds and a better opportunity to explore your preferred points of interest.

3. Connect with Locals: Interacting with locals is a great way to learn about and discover unique insights about the hidden treasures of your chosen destination. Strike up conversations, ask for recommendations, and take in the knowledge they can offer.
4. Nature's Bounty: Spring is the perfect time to feast upon the wonders of the great outdoors. Seek out destinations that feature stunning landscapes, including lakes, forests, or hiking trails. Immersing yourself in nature will restore your sanity and your spirit, and create lasting memories.
5. Cultural Immersion: I cannot say this enough……immerse yourself in local culture. Sure, I have visited all-inclusive resorts and swanky hotels. What do I remember the most? Local culture of course! Visit festivals, museums, art galleries, and events to understand the fabric of the place and the heart of the people you're visiting. Engaging and participating with the culture and traditions of your destination will give you a more meaningful experience.

6. Offbeat Adventures: Spring break brings to mind images of bustling resorts and vibrant beach parties but that doesn't mean those are your only options. Seek out unconventional activities like helicopter tours of your destination, hot air balloon rides over gorgeous landscapes, or something more adventurous parasailing or paragliding. These unique experiences will create memories that stand out from the usual crowd.
